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"alyaksandr sychou" in English
English translation for "
alyaksandr sychou
"
亚历山大瑟丘
Similar Words:
"alyade" English translation
,
"alyaji" English translation
,
"alyakrinski" English translation
,
"alyakrinsky" English translation
,
"alyakritsky" English translation
,
"alyame" English translation
,
"alyamov" English translation
,
"alyamovski" English translation
,
"alyamovsky" English translation
,
"alyan" English translation